In the shut parison course of action, BFS machines don't have a conventional air shower like in isolators or RABS. The filling needles are totally enclosed within the parison so it is actually impossible to accomplish constant practical and non-viable particle checking all through the filling of a batch, since you would have to penetrate the parison.

While in the BFS method, the plastic raw product is melted, extruded into a cylindrical tube (called a parison), and shaped right into a container by blowing sterile air or nitrogen into your tube to pressure the plastic into the shape from the mould.

It is commonly Utilized in the foodstuff and pharmaceutical industries for packaging several products and solutions. This technology allows automate the packaging method, escalating performance, and lowering the need for guide labor.

Lastly, the BFS molds open, letting the filled and completed BFS container to go away the equipment inside of a continuous strip and move ahead to the next period of the manufacturing line. The BFS method is then repeated for the next number of containers.

Once the container is shaped, it can be then filled with sterile liquid. The equipment design and style makes certain that the liquid is aseptically launched into the container, retaining its sterility.
